Pinellas County SBE Consultants per the Consultant Competitive Negotiations Act (CCNA)
Solicitation # 26-0853-RFQ-CCNA
Pinellas County's Office of Management and Budget is seeking to establish a pool of certified Small Business Enterprise (SBE) consultants under the Consultant Competitive Negotiations Act (CCNA). This ongoing solicitation aims to increase the utilization of SBEs for professional services including engineering, architectural, landscape architecture, planning, coastal management, construction management, and survey and mapping. The program specifically targets work assignments that do not exceed the 150,000 dollar local market threshold. To be eligible, firms must be located in Pinellas, Hillsborough, Pasco, or Manatee counties, employ no more than 50 full-time staff, and meet annual gross revenue limits of 3 million dollars for selective goods and services or 8 million dollars for construction providers. Applicants are evaluated based on the ability of professional personnel, experience and past performance, and SBE status, requiring a minimum score of 75 points to be accepted onto the shortlist. Required submission documents include an introduction letter, a completed SF-330, a Pinellas County SBE certificate, professional Florida licenses, and a signed insurance statement. All engineering and survey deliverables must adhere to the latest Pinellas County CADD Standards Manual and Kit. Insurance requirements include 1 million dollars for professional liability and commercial general liability per occurrence, with specific mandates for tail coverage and naming Pinellas County as an additional insured.

This contract supports small businesses in obtaining and maintaining key socioeconomic certifications such as Woman-Owned Small Business WOSB,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Business SDVOSB, and HUBZone status, while ensuring compliance with joint venture disclosure requirements. The work involves providing expert consulting services to guide businesses through the certification process, documentation, and regulatory adherence necessary to qualify for federal contracting opportunities reserved for these designated groups. The scope is focused on helping clients navigate complex federal rules and maximize their eligibility for set-aside contracts. The contract is issued as a subcontract under NAICS code 541611 for management consulting services, with performance based in Tracy, California, at ZIP code 95304-5000. It was posted on June 24, 2026, and responses are due by June 30, 2026, with the ordering agency being the DLA San Joaquin office under the Department of Defense. There is no specified set-aside type, and the solicitation is accessible through the DIBBS system under reference number SPE8ES26T2225. The work requires a thorough understanding of federal small business certification rules and the ability to deliver accurate, timely guidance to ensure client compliance and certification success.

VALVE, GATE
Solicitation # SPE7MC-26-T-240Q
Solicitation SPE7MC-26-T-240Q is a request for quotations issued by DLA Land and Maritime for the procurement of 15 gate valves, identified by NSN 4820-01-672-6185 and Parker Hannifin Corporation part number 10573-B. The items are designated as critical application items and are to be delivered to DLA Distribution San Joaquin in Tracy, California. The original required delivery date is August 12, 2026, with a need ship date of June 29, 2027, and a delivery window of 291 days after award. The contract is categorized under NAICS code 336413 and requires the use of the Wide Area WorkFlow system for electronic invoicing and payment. The procurement mandates strict adherence to quality and technical standards, including ISO 9001:2015 compliance for manufacturer inspection systems and sampling methods per MIL-STD-1916 or ASQ H1331. Packaging must comply with RP001 and MIL-STD-129, with specific requirements for hazardous material labeling under the Hazard Communication Standard. Inspection and acceptance will occur at the destination. Offerors must comply with domestic material restrictions, including the Buy American Act and the Berry Amendment, and represent that they will not provide covered telecommunications equipment. The solicitation incorporates various FAR and DFARS clauses regarding sustainable products, cybersecurity safeguarding, and the prohibition of trafficking in persons.
